Ordinals
beta
Address 3NAuchFp6e2MgdDNvDV4ukGkb6jQQWtMEM
sat balance
10612
outputs
609c4957713addbe095af08cd34aad35e2b9eac9d9c6bb8d2b2495e4f8b3cb0b:1899
66997e177befcce744baf0f91da08b6ce496d440cc4ba82f822338bae4076362:2973
034ff02a8a801d9d5b8cd5f7f09966a064f34fb829a49b32710eeaf113ada0e1:123